viticulturist

Intermediate (B1)

IPA: /ˈvɪtɪˌkʌltʃərɪst/

KK: /ˈvɪtɪˌkʌltʃərɪst/

noun
Definition

A person who cultivates and manages grapevines, typically for winemaking.


Example

The viticulturist carefully monitored the growth of the grapevines throughout the season.

Root Explanation

Viticulturist → It is formed from "vitis" (meaning vine) and "cultura" (meaning cultivation). The word refers to a person who cultivates grapevines, particularly for winemaking.
